What companies run services between Pretoria, South Africa and Hebron?

There is no direct connection from Pretoria to Hebron. However, you can take the taxi to Johannesburg-Airport-JNB airport, fly to Ben Gurion Airport (TLV), walk to נתב''ג, take the train to Yerushalayim/Yits'hak Navon, walk to Jerusalem Central Bus Station 3rd Floor/Platforms, then take the bus to הרצי''ה קוק/יצחק טבנקין. Alternatively, you can take the taxi to Johannesburg-Airport-JNB airport, fly to Queen Alia International Airport (AMM), walk to Queen Alia Airport, take the bus to Amman Tabarbour Terminal, take the taxi to Abdali, take the bus to King Hussein Bridge, drive to City Hall, take the line 174 bus to שדרות שז''ר/בנייני האומה, walk to Jerusalem Central Bus Station 3rd Floor/Platforms, then take the bus to הרצי''ה קוק/יצחק טבנקין.
